    Adding field to calculate sum of a field and count of a field in pivot table

    Hi all

    I have set up a pivot table, which shows the count of one field and the sum of another. My aim is to add a further column which will divide one by the other. I have tried to do this using the calculation field function, but it only allows me to divide the original fields, not the count and sum I have created in the values area of the table.

    I have attached the table below. I would like the extra field to divide sum of runners by count of races.
